Who food preparation equipment is for
Prep is where the working day is won or lost. Every venue that processes fresh produce in volume — restaurants dicing onions by the kilo, cafés portioning salads, delis slicing smallgoods to order, bakeries kneading dough through the early hours — runs faster and more consistently with the right prep machine doing the repetitive work. Hand-prep is fine at low covers; once you're feeding a lunch rush or a function, a processor, slicer or mixer pays for itself in labour hours and even portioning. The gear here suits cafés, pubs, RSLs, restaurants, ghost kitchens, caterers and food trucks alike.
What's in scope
Food processors
Bowl-cut processors and combination machines that chop, blend, purée and emulsify in seconds — the everyman of the prep bench. Linked above is the full processor range; for one machine that does both bowl work and produce, the combination food and veg processors pair a cutter bowl with a vegetable-prep attachment in a single unit.
Vegetable cutters and discs
Continuous-feed vegetable preparation machines slice, shred, grate, julienne and dice produce at a rate hand-prep can't touch — feed in carrots, cabbage or potatoes and they come out the chute uniformly cut. The cut depends on the disc fitted, and our veg cutter discs range covers the slicing, grating and dicing plates that swap in for each job.
Slicers
Gravity-feed and manual commercial meat slicers deliver clean, even slices of smallgoods, cooked meats and cheese — adjustable thickness from wafer-thin shaved ham to thick-cut roast. Delis, sandwich bars and venues plating charcuterie rely on them for consistency and yield.
Mixers
Bakery and dough mixers do the heavy lifting on the wet end of prep. Our commercial spiral mixers are built for bread and pizza dough — the spiral hook develops gluten without overheating the dough — while planetary mixers handle batters, creams and lighter mixes across a wider range of jobs.
Prep benches
None of it works without a surface to work on. Hard-wearing stainless steel benches give you the hygienic, non-porous prep zone that food-safety practice expects — easy to sanitise, won't harbour bacteria, and tough enough to take the daily knocks of a working kitchen.
How to choose food preparation equipment in three steps
Matching prep gear to your kitchen comes down to three questions, in order.
Step 1 — What are you actually prepping, and how much?
Start with the job and the volume. Cutting trays of vegetables every morning points to a continuous-feed vegetable cutter; slicing smallgoods to order points to a meat slicer; daily dough means a mixer sized to your batch. Estimate your busiest day's volume, not your average — the machine needs to clear your peak without becoming the bottleneck.
Step 2 — Match the capacity to your service
Prep machines are rated by throughput or bowl size. A small café gets by with a benchtop processor and a compact mixer; a high-volume kitchen needs a floor-standing vegetable prep machine and a larger-capacity bowl. Size up if you're growing — running a machine constantly at its limit wears it out faster and slows your prep.
Step 3 — Check power, footprint and cleaning
Confirm whether the unit runs off a standard 10-amp outlet or needs a dedicated circuit, and measure the bench or floor space it occupies. Then look at how it strips down for cleaning — prep equipment touches raw food daily, so removable, dishwasher-safe parts make end-of-service hygiene quick and keep you on the right side of HACCP.

What's the difference between a food processor and a vegetable cutter?
A food processor works in batches in a bowl — it chops, blends, purées and emulsifies, ideal for sauces, dips, pastes and fine mixes. A continuous-feed vegetable cutter (or food cutter) runs produce through a feed chute against a rotating disc, so it slices, shreds and dices a steady stream of vegetables without stopping. Many venues run both; combination food-and-veg processors pair the two in one machine.
What machine dices vegetables quickly?
A dicing machine — usually a vegetable cutter fitted with a dicing grid and disc — is the fastest way to dice produce in volume. The vegetable passes through a slicing blade then a grid that cuts it into even cubes in a single action, turning a manual job of many minutes into seconds. The dice size is set by the grid and disc you fit, so check which dicing kits suit the machine.
What equipment do I need to make salad in volume?
For high-volume salad prep, a continuous-feed vegetable cutter (often called a salad maker) does the bulk slicing, shredding and grating, while a refrigerated salad prep bench gives you a chilled work surface with ingredient wells within arm's reach. Together they let one person assemble salads at speed while keeping produce at a safe temperature through service.
What is a food cutter used for?
A food cutter — the term covers both bowl-cutter food processors and continuous-feed vegetable cutters — is used to reduce raw ingredients to a consistent size or texture quickly. That might mean chopping herbs, shredding cheese, slicing cabbage for coleslaw, or grating carrot for a service, all in a fraction of the time hand-prep takes.
Which mixer should I choose for dough?
For bread and pizza dough, a spiral mixer is the standard choice — its fixed spiral hook develops gluten efficiently while keeping the dough cool, so it suits dense, high-hydration doughs and longer mixes. A planetary mixer is the more versatile all-rounder for batters, creams, icings and lighter doughs. Bakeries running dough daily usually start with a spiral mixer sized to their batch.
Why do commercial kitchens use stainless steel prep benches?
Stainless steel is non-porous, corrosion-resistant and easy to sanitise, which is exactly what food-safety practice calls for in a prep area. It won't absorb moisture or harbour bacteria the way timber or laminate can, it stands up to harsh cleaning chemicals, and it takes the daily wear of a working kitchen — which is why it's the default surface for commercial prep.

The Hamilton Beach Commercial COH0500 is a heavy-duty manual can opener that opens the side seam of the can instead of puncturing the lid, leaving no sharp edges on the can or lid and keeping the blade away from food. A can-locking mechanism secures the cutter to the lid for smooth, fast opening of cans up to #10 size (157 mm diameter, 178 mm high), and the unit mounts permanently to the countertop for busy prep areas.
Why operators choose the COH0500
Side-cut action opens the can seam — no sharp edges and no blade contact with food, unlike conventional can openers
Can-locking mechanism holds the cutter to the lid for smooth, fast opening
Heavy-duty stainless steel cutter is built to cut thousands of cans and is easily replaceable, with replacement parts available
Direct-drive design with no gears to wear or break removes a common cause of downtime
Integrated can rest lets cans rotate freely during operation

Frequently asked questions
What size cans can the COH0500 open?
It handles cans up to #10 size — 157 mm in diameter and 178 mm high — and the arm raises and lowers to accommodate different can sizes.
How is a side-cut can opener safer than a conventional one?
It opens the can along the side seam instead of puncturing the lid, so there are no sharp edges on the can or lid, and no blade makes contact with the food, avoiding cross-contamination.
How does it mount to the bench?
It installs permanently on the countertop using the included mounting plate and stainless steel screws, with a pull pin that quickly releases the cutter housing for cleaning.
Can the cutter be replaced when it wears?
Yes — the heavy-duty stainless steel cutter is built to cut thousands of cans and is easily replaceable, with replacement parts available.
Will it fit an existing Edlund mounting position?
Yes — the manufacturer states it uses the same mounting pattern as Edlund can openers, making changeover straightforward.
The Orved VBCEXL2030 is a pack of 100 channel vacuum sealer bags (200 x 300 mm) made for out-of-chamber (external suction) vacuum sealer models. The coextruded 75µ polyamide/polyethylene film carries a channelled (embossed) side that lets an out-of-chamber machine draw air fully out of the bag before sealing, protecting food quality and extending storage life.Why operators choose the VBCEXL2030
Channelled (embossed) film side allows complete air extraction on out-of-chamber vacuum sealers — the bag style these machines require
Coextruded PA/PE construction — 75 µm smooth side with a 190–220 µm channelled side for reliable 8 mm-wide seals
Suits pasteurisation up to 70°C (max 2 hours) or 100°C (15 minutes) and freezing down to -25°C per the manufacturer data sheet
Food-contact compliant per the manufacturer declaration, with recyclability classification >PA+LDPE< 7
100 bags per pack, with a second size available (VBCEXL2536 (250 x 360 mm)) to match different portion and product shapes
